Benjamin Trainor
upvc-windows-doors0595
- Germany
- http://6068688.xyz:3000/window-door-company8803
-
Looking for top-quality windows & doors near me? Discover a wide selection of premium options at competitive prices to enhance your home today!
- Joined on Jul 08, 2025
No matching repositories found.